Analysis
United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land recorded 6.0% for expenditure on education as % of gdp or public expenditure in 2011.
That represents a change of down 2.8% on the previous year and up 30.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, expenditure on education as % of gdp or public expenditure in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land peaked at 6.2% in 2010 and was at its lowest, 4.5%, in 1999.
That places United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land 10th out of 42 countries with data for 2011,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 21 years of available data.
Expenditure on education as % of GDP or public expenditure in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, year by year
| Year | Percentage |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1991 | 5.2% | — |
| 1992 | 5.3% | +1.9% |
| 1993 | 5.4% | +1.9% |
| 1994 | 5.4% | +0.0% |
| 1995 | 5.0% | -7.0% |
| 1996 | 5.1% | +1.6% |
| 1997 | 5.0% | -2.5% |
| 1998 | 4.8% | -4.0% |
| 1999 | 4.5% | -6.3% |
| 2000 | 4.6% | +3.8% |
| 2001 | 4.6% | -1.3% |
| 2002 | 5.1% | +10.5% |
| 2003 | 5.2% | +3.0% |
| 2004 | 5.1% | -1.7% |
| 2005 | 5.3% | +3.7% |
| 2006 | 5.4% | +1.3% |
| 2007 | 5.3% | -1.7% |
| 2008 | 5.3% | -0.2% |
| 2009 | 5.6% | +5.3% |
| 2010 | 6.2% | +10.6% |
| 2011 | 6.0% | -2.8% |
